Crimson Desert Surprises with Its Reality
Pearl Abyss is preparing to set a new standard in the gaming world with Crimson Desert, scheduled for release in 2025. The development team showcased the game’s physics engine and detailed world at GDC 2025. Set in the medieval high fantasy world of Pywel, Crimson Desert offers astonishing realism with both visual and physical details.
Crimson Desert and its Extraordinary Physics Engine
Crimson Desert is being prepared with an improved version of the custom game engine that the development team previously used for Black Desert Online. During the introduction at GDC 2025, the team showed how advanced the game’s physics engine is. For example, the effect of wind on fabric and hair, the harmony of light with shadows, and the effect of different weather conditions on environmental elements were conveyed in detail.

One of the most striking moments of the trailer was the scene where a horse enters the water. The fact that only the parts of the horse that come into contact with water get wet and that these details are accurately reflected after it comes out of the water offered players a unique reality. Such details clearly reveal how advanced the game’s physics engine is.
The game tells the story of a mercenary named Kliff. Kliff embarks on difficult conflicts and dangerous missions to prevent Pywel from falling into chaos. The game’s open world combines exploration, combat, and storytelling, aiming to offer players an immersive experience.
Crimson Desert will be released for P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X/S platforms towards the end of 2025. Pearl Abyss states that the game is ambitious not only in terms of visuals and technical aspects, but also in terms of story. Crimson Desert, which brings an innovative touch to the gaming world, has already managed to become one of the most anticipated productions of the year with its realism and attention to detail.
